The San Francisco Public Library Project (SFPLP) is a weekly study of visitors moving through the library space. The as-shot unaltered photographs serve to document the observations we collectively see but don't necessarily record. Each photograph captures an impression of a visitor within the library setting where color, movement and texture intersect to evoke an imaginary story from the viewer's perspective.
